By linking survey data with #longitudinal #register data, study examines the predictive power of immigrants’ #migration expectations in the Netherlands and finds that expectations such as return or onward migration are strong predictors of actual #behaviour. https://www.demographic-research.org/articles/volume/52/35

Two new Technical Education Learner Survey reports have been published.

They draw on the progression of the second T Level cohort and comparator learners, exploring learners' experiences and short-term outcomes. The reports also focus on post-course progression of level 4/5 learners, exploring learner outcomes, future plans and their reflections on level 4/5 qualifications.
